Article 7: Data Governance & Analytics: Unlocking Actionable Insights from Wholesale Data (300+ words)

Problem: Wholesalers collect vast amounts of data, but often struggle to derive meaningful insights.
What is Data Governance? Ensuring data quality, consistency, security, and compliance across the organization.
Key Data Sources: ERP, WMS, CRM, e-commerce platforms, IoT sensors, external market data.
Business Intelligence (BI) Tools: Creating dashboards and reports to visualize key performance indicators (KPIs) like inventory turnover, customer churn, order fill rates.
Predictive Analytics: Using data to forecast sales, identify potential supply chain risks, and optimize pricing.
Benefits: Improved decision-making, increased operational efficiency, better understanding of customer behavior, identification of new market opportunities.
